Written Answers. - Local Authority Housing Allocations.

Eamon Gilmore

Question:

320 Mr. Gilmore asked the Minister for the Environment the moneys which have been allocated in each year since the enactment of the Housing Act, 1988 under section 10 of the Act; the amount of the allocation which was spent in each of these years; and the local authorities which applied for funding under section 10.

The amounts provided for the making of recoupments to housing authorities under section 10 of the Housing Act, 1988 in 1988, 1989 and 1990 were £400,000, £500,000 and £600,000, respectively. The total amounts expended from these provisions were £7,473.60 and £115,220.10 in 1989 and 1990, respectively. There was no expenditure in 1988 as section 10 was not brought into operation until 1 January, 1989.

Applications for recoupment were received from the following housing authorities: Carlow County Council, Donegal County Council, Kilkenny County Council, Laois County Council, Limerick County Council, Longford County Council, Roscommon County Council, Tipperary SR County Council, Wexford County Council, Cork Corporation, Galway Corporation, Limerick Corporation, Waterford Corporation, Buncrana UDC, Bundoran UDC, Letterkenny UDC, Sligo Corporation, Tralee UDC, Westport UDC, Youghal UDC.
